We have an opportunity for an Electronics Hardware Calibration Technician to join the team at our Silverstone facility. In this role, you will be responsible for the calibration and validation of all electronic hardware systems used in our racing operations.   • Performing calibration and validation of all electronic systems in line with performance requirements
  • Identifying and rectifying calibration issues and ensuring the reliability of all electronics
  • Support the development of calibration procedures and test routines
  • Engaging in data analysis and providing insights to enhance system performance

Requirements

What do we need from you?

  • A degree in a relevant discipline (Engineering/Electronics) or similar, or equivalent
  • Experience with the calibration of electronic systems, preferably in the motorsport sector
  • Strong understanding of electronic hardware and associated software
  • Experience with motorsport data acquisition and telemetry systems
  • Proficiency in programming languages such as C, C++, or Python, particularly for automation tasks
  • Strong communication skills and ability to collaborate with multi-disciplinary teams
